Abstract
This invention relates to a method for the separation of stereoisomers of 7-hydroxy-furo[3,4-c]pyridine derivatives of the formula ##STR1## wherein R.sub.3, R.sub.4 and R.sub.6 represent various substitutents, which comprises reacting a fully O-acetylated monosaccharide halogenide with a racemate of the selected 7-hydroxy-furo[3,4-c]pyridine derivative, to form the (+) and (-) (O-acetylated monosaccharide) (furo[3,4-c] pyridine 7-yl derivative) ethers, then separating the (+) and the (-) ethers by selective crystallization, in an hydroalcoholic medium, either of the acetylated forms or of the corresponding desacetylated forms and, finally, working up each of the separated derivatives by the usual routes. The compounds are known pharmaceuticals.
